Originally Posted by 00DakDan
It's the 3.9.

First try this to read the codes. With the engine OFF, turn the key to RUN (don't start it), then back to OFF, back to RUN, back to OFF, then LEAVE IT in RUN.

Any codes will display in the odometer window.

I'm thinking you have a lockup clutch or solenoid problem in transmission. The codes may help narrow it down.
It turned out to be the solenoid problem with the transmission;I took it to a dealer and $70 later they figured it out, they're gonna charge me about $700 to fix it, but unfortunately my brakes also blew out so I'm stuck there
